Earlier today, by a vote of 194 to 159 the New Hampshire House of Representatives failed to muster the two-thirds needed to override the Governor Sununu’s veto of House Bill 142 (Burgess BioPower bill). House Bill 142 sought to modify certain provisions of the power purchase agreement between this facility and EVERSOURCE. Its failure to become law creates a cloud of uncertainty about the future operation of this facility. As the state’s largest destination for low-grade timber (consuming over 750,000 tons/year), any disruption to this market will send a ripple through the entire industry and will impact forestry projects.

Currently, the owners of the facility are assessing the impact of today’s vote and options. The NHTOA will continue to monitor the situation and work to keep its members informed of any developments.
